Braemar Hotels & Resorts (BHR) currently reports a total liabilities of $1.3B as of March 2026. That compares with $1.4B in the prior-year period — down 4.0% year over year. Use the charts on this page to explore Braemar Hotels & Resorts's total liabilities history and peer comparisons.
